CVE-2024-20470 in RV340info

Summary

by MITRE • 10/02/2024

A vulnerability in the web-based management interface of Cisco Small Business RV340, RV340W, RV345, and RV345P Dual WAN Gigabit VPN Routers could allow an authenticated, remote attacker to execute arbitrary code on an affected device. In order to exploit this vulnerability, the attacker must have valid admin credentials.

This vulnerability exists because the web-based management interface does not sufficiently validate user-supplied input. An attacker could exploit this vulnerability by sending crafted HTTP input to an affected device. A successful exploit could allow the attacker to execute arbitrary code as the root user on the underlying operating system.

Statistical analysis made it clear that VulDB provides the best quality for vulnerability data.

Analysis

by VulDB Data Team • 10/10/2024

The vulnerability identified as CVE-2024-20470 represents a critical security flaw within the web-based management interface of Cisco Small Business routers including the RV340, RV340W, RV345, and RV345P models. This issue stems from insufficient input validation mechanisms that fail to properly sanitize user-supplied data, creating a pathway for malicious actors to manipulate the system through crafted HTTP requests. The vulnerability specifically affects the dual WAN gigabit VPN router series, which are commonly deployed in small business environments where centralized network management is essential for operations.

The technical exploitation of this vulnerability requires an attacker to possess valid administrative credentials, establishing a privilege escalation scenario where authenticated access leads to remote code execution. The flaw manifests when the web interface processes HTTP input without adequate validation checks, allowing malicious payloads to be executed within the router's operating system context. This vulnerability directly maps to CWE-20, which describes "Improper Input Validation" as a fundamental weakness in software design that permits malformed input to be processed without proper sanitization. The consequence of successful exploitation enables attackers to execute arbitrary code with root privileges, effectively providing complete control over the affected device's underlying operating system.

From an operational impact perspective, this vulnerability poses significant risks to small business networks that rely on these routers for their connectivity infrastructure. The combination of remote code execution capability with authenticated access means that attackers who gain administrative credentials can compromise entire network operations, potentially leading to data breaches, network disruption, or use as a foothold for further attacks within the organization's network perimeter. The attack surface is particularly concerning given that these routers are typically deployed in environments where network security monitoring may be limited, making detection of such attacks more challenging. This vulnerability aligns with ATT&CK technique T1059.007, which covers "Command and Scripting Interpreter: PowerShell" but extends beyond scripting to encompass direct operating system command execution through web interface manipulation.

The mitigation strategies for CVE-2024-20470 should prioritize immediate implementation of Cisco's security advisories and firmware updates to address the input validation deficiencies. Network administrators should enforce strict access controls and credential management practices, including regular credential rotation and multi-factor authentication where possible. Additional protective measures include network segmentation to limit access to administrative interfaces, implementation of network monitoring to detect unusual traffic patterns, and regular security assessments of network infrastructure. The vulnerability underscores the importance of maintaining up-to-date firmware and implementing defense-in-depth strategies that minimize the attack surface for critical network infrastructure components. Organizations should also consider implementing network access controls that restrict administrative access to only necessary personnel and systems, reducing the likelihood that valid administrative credentials will be compromised and exploited.

Responsible

Cisco

Reservation

11/08/2023

Disclosure

10/02/2024

Moderation

accepted

CPE

ready

EPSS

0.00630

KEV

no

Activities

very low

Sources

Want to know what is going to be exploited?

We predict KEV entries!